Tracking and Fleet Telemetry
Configurations focused on standard vehicle tracking: ignition, inputs/outputs, GPS, accelerometer, ECU, and counters, reporting to a Pegasus destination.
Pegasus (full tracking)
A full-featured tracking configuration that reports IO, GNSS, network, and ECU data along with global counters (odometer, ignition time, idle time, over-speed, over-RPM). Handles ignition, inputs/outputs, short-circuit detection, power loss/restore, low battery, sleep/wake power-save events, GPS loss, harsh acceleration, hard braking, and a parked event driven by a 5-minute timer after ignition off. Sends everything to the pegasus destination.

Configurations that fall back to a satellite modem when the cellular link goes down.
Satcom
A companion configuration to satellite_modem.syrus.conf destination. When the modem has no connection for more than 600 seconds, it enables the satcom_destination, emits a stcm event, and disables the satellite destination again once cellular is restored.
# sample satcom configuration messages
# requires the satellite_modem.syrus.conf destination file
# create a group for the satcom events
define group satmsgs
# create a fieldset to append satcom information to the event messages
define fieldset satcom_fields fields=$satcom
# defines disconnected as more than 600 seconds with no connection from the modem
define signal disconnected $modem.no_conn_time > 600
# action to enable the satcom destination
define action enable_satcom trigger=disconnected enable destination satcom_destination
# action to send a satcom event when disconnected
define action send_satcom_event trigger=disconnected send event start_satcom
# action to disable the satcom destination
define action disable_satcom trigger=disconnected,not disable destination satcom_destination
# event when no connection
define event start_satcom group=satmsgs fieldset=satcom_fields ack=disabled label=stcm code=10 trigger=disconnected
# set destination for satmsgs to satcom destination
set destinations group=satmsgs satcom_destinationTutorial and Advanced Features
